當前位置:編程學習大全網 - 網站源碼 - 詳解下java中的BufferedReader語句如何用

詳解下java中的BufferedReader語句如何用

BufferedReader bufferedReader =new BufferedReader(new InputStreamReader(System.in));

創建了壹個BufferedReader對象, 名字是bufferedReader , 然後new, 傳入了壹個InputStream對象.因為使用了BufferedReader的構造方法,

BufferedReader是緩沖流, INputStream是字節流

可以想象成壹個水管, 在INputStream外面包了壹層, 以供讀取方便, 就簡單理解成, InputStream這個水管壹下只能有壹滴水從這裏通過, 而BufferedReader套在這個水管上, 就可以壹下讀壹串水流

system.in 是放到標準的鍵盤設備上

然後在命令行打印壹句話 請輸入壹系列文字,可包括空格

然後用bufferedreader調用bufferedreader的readline方法, readline是讀取壹行的方法, 也就是說妳輸入的數字會被讀取, 然後放在 text裏面

註意: readline這個方法是阻塞式的, 意思是妳不輸入我就在那等, 什麽時候妳輸入了, 我的程序才會往下執行

然後最後壹個打印 請輸入文字 後面加上 讀取的東西...

多看看java基礎吧

  • 上一篇:電腦如何在手機上查看淘寶?
  • 下一篇:想看壹部美國電影,忘了片名
  • copyright 2024編程學習大全網